25 # We are using a recursive build, so we need to do a little thinking
26 # to get the ordering right.
27 #
28 # Most importantly: sub-Makefiles should only ever modify files in
29 # their own directory. If in some directory we have a dependency on
30 # a file in another dir (which doesn't happen often, but it's often
31 # unavoidable when linking the built-in.a targets which finally
32 # turn into vmlinux), we will call a sub make in that other dir, and
33 # after that we are sure that everything which is in that other dir
34 # is now up to date.
35 #
36 # The only cases where we need to modify files which have global
37 # effects are thus separated out and done before the recursive
38 # descending is started. They are now explicitly listed as the
39 # prepare rule.

60 # Beautify output
61 # ---------------------------------------------------------------------------
62 #
63 # Most of build commands in Kbuild start with "cmd_". You can optionally define
64 # "quiet_cmd_*". If defined, the short log is printed. Otherwise, no log from
65 # that command is printed by default.
66 #
67 # e.g.)
68 #    quiet_cmd_depmod = DEPMOD  $(MODLIB)
69 #          cmd_depmod = $(srctree)/scripts/depmod.sh $(DEPMOD) $(KERNELRELEASE)
70 #
71 # A simple variant is to prefix commands with $(Q) - that's useful
72 # for commands that shall be hidden in non-verbose mode.
73 #
74 #    $(Q)$(MAKE) $(build)=scripts/basic
75 #
76 # If KBUILD_VERBOSE contains 1, the whole command is echoed.
77 # If KBUILD_VERBOSE contains 2, the reason for rebuilding is printed.
78 #
79 # To put more focus on warnings, be less verbose as default
80 # Use 'make V=1' to see the full commands

158 # Kbuild will save output files in the current working directory.
159 # This does not need to match to the root of the kernel source tree.
160 #
161 # For example, you can do this:
162 #
163 #  cd /dir/to/store/output/files; make -f /dir/to/kernel/source/Makefile
164 #
165 # If you want to save output files in a different location, there are
166 # two syntaxes to specify it.
167 #
168 # 1) O=
169 # Use "make O=dir/to/store/output/files/"
170 #
171 # 2) Set KBUILD_OUTPUT
172 # Set the environment variable KBUILD_OUTPUT to point to the output directory.
173 # export KBUILD_OUTPUT=dir/to/store/output/files/; make
174 #
175 # The O= assignment takes precedence over the KBUILD_OUTPUT environment
176 # variable.

375 # Cross compiling and selecting different set of gcc/bin-utils
376 # ---------------------------------------------------------------------------
377 #
378 # When performing cross compilation for other architectures ARCH shall be set
379 # to the target architecture. (See arch/* for the possibilities).
380 # ARCH can be set during invocation of make:
381 # make ARCH=ia64
382 # Another way is to have ARCH set in the environment.
383 # The default ARCH is the host where make is executed.
384 
385 # CROSS_COMPILE specify the prefix used for all executables used
386 # during compilation. Only gcc and related bin-utils executables
387 # are prefixed with $(CROSS_COMPILE).
388 # CROSS_COMPILE can be set on the command line
389 # make CROSS_COMPILE=ia64-linux-
390 # Alternatively CROSS_COMPILE can be set in the environment.
391 # Default value for CROSS_COMPILE is not to prefix executables
392 # Note: Some architectures assign CROSS_COMPILE in their arch/*/Makefile

1474 ###
1475 # Cleaning is done on three levels.
1476 # make clean     Delete most generated files
1477 #                Leave enough to build external modules
1478 # make mrproper  Delete the current configuration, and all generated files
1479 # make distclean Remove editor backup files, patch leftover files and the like
